Transaction d6ba1115cd9560536e2da32417cacdea4aec6947f8e1f67c15c8a018746d18c8
1 Input
1 Output
-
d6ba1115cd9560536e2da32417cacdea4aec6947f8e1f67c15c8a018746d18c8:0
- value
- 2316854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 108b29f1de59d334863f31b2f3b6635d5005a851 OP_EQUAL
- address
- 33CVStNtmLZRW7x51UuxBCHWaX7nskNMpR